About this book :-
Special Functions for Applied Scientists written by A M Mathai, H J Haubold.
The lecture notes are written up in a style for self-study. Each topic is developed from first principles with lots of worked examples and exercises. Hence the material in this book can be used for self-study and will help anyone to understand the basic ideas in the area of Special Functions and Functions of Matrix Argument and they will be able to make use of these results in their own problems in applied areas, especially in Statistics, Physics and Engineering problems. Applications in various areas are illustrated in this book. Insights into recent developments in the applications of fractional calculus, in the developments in various other topics are also given in the book so that the readers who are interested in any of the topics discussed in the book can directly go into a research problem in the topics.
Introduces elementary classical special functions. Gamma, beta, psi, zeta functions, hypergeometric functions and the associated special functions, generalizations to Meijer's G and Fox's H-functions are examined here. Discussion is confined to basic properties and selected applications. Introduction to statistical distribution theory is provided. Some recent extensions of Dirichlet integrals and Dirichlet densities are discussed. A glimpse into multivariable special functions such as Appell's functions and Lauricella functions

About Author :-
Arak Mathai Arakaparampil Mathai "Arak" Mathai (born 1935) is an Indian mathematician who has worked in Statistics, Applied Analysis, Applications of special functions and Astrophysics. Mathai established the Centre for Mathematical Sciences, Palai, Kerala, India.
He has published more 25 books and more than 300 research publications. In 1998 he received the Founder Recognition Award from the Statistical Society of Canada. He is a Fellow of the National Academy of Sciences, India and a Fellow of the Institute of Mathematical Statistics. After completing his high school education in 1953 from St. Thomas High School, Palai with record marks he joined St. Thomas College, Palai and obtained his B Sc. degree in Mathematics in 1957. In 1959 he completed his master's degree in Statistics from University of Kerala, Thiruvananthapuram, Kerala, India with first class, first rank and gold medal. Then he joined St. Thomas College, Palai, University of Kerala, as a lecturer in Statistics and served there till 1961. He obtained Canadian Commonwealth scholarship in 1961 and went to University of Toronto, Canada for completing his MA degree in Mathematics in 1962. He was awarded PhD from University of Toronto, Canada in 1964. Then he joined McGill University, Canada as an Assistant Professor till 1968. From 1968 to 1978 he was an Associate Professor there. He became a Full Professor of McGill in 1979 and served the Department of Mathematics and Statistics until 2000. From 2000 onwards he was an Emeritus Professor of McGill University.

Book Contents :-
Special Functions for Applied Scientists written by A M Mathai, H J Haubold cover the following topics.
1. Basic Ideas of Special Functions and Statistical Distributions
2. Mittag-Leffler Functions and Fractional Calculus
3. An Introduction to q-Series
4. Ramanujan’s Theories of Theta and Elliptic Functions
5. Lie Group and Special Functions
6. Applications to Stochastic Process and Time Series
7. Applications to Density Estimation
8. Applications to Order Statistics
9. Applications to Astrophysics Problems
10. An Introduction toWavelet Analysis
11. Jacobians of Matrix Transformations
12. Special Functions of Matrix Argument
